Hello. (using 1.90 RC3 but seems to same for previous versions)

XnView can't copy with the short dos filename convention very well.

Set "Mode when starting with a file" to "Fullscreen - Browser".
I have a picture in C:\Vince\mylongfolder\picture.png
At the command line start XnView with a file using the short filename convention:

"C:\Vince\Apps\XnView-rc3\xnview.exe" C:\Vince\MYLONG~1\picture.png

This incorrectly starts XnView in browser mode.

Using option "Mode when starting with a file" to "Fullscreen - Edit" works fine - the image opens fullscreen.

(see http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/8.3)
